The Milestones: Tesla Production Figures

Teslas production capabilities have been growing at an impressive pace since its inception. This growth is a testimony to the large-scale demand for electric vehicles. The company has taken leaps and bounds in production capabilities, crossing impressive milestones on a regular basis. For instance, Tesla reached the one-million-cars-produced milestone in March 2020. Furthermore, Tesla produced and delivered over half a million vehicles in 2020 alone, an astounding 36% increase from the previous year despite the challenges 2020 had to offer.

Market Domination: Teslas Share of EV Sales

Teslas prominence in the electric vehicle market is undisputed. It is consistently capturing a significant share of the global electric vehicle sales figures. In 2020, Tesla had a staggering 16% share of global electric vehicle sales, outpacing its competitors such as BYD and Volkswagen. This clearly reflects Teslas strong hold in the market, providing a diverse lineup of cars catering to various segments of the electric vehicle market.

Benchmark Performance: Tesla Vehicle Specs

Teslas electric vehicles do not just boast of immaculate design and ecological impact. They also promise and deliver stellar performance. Teslas current lineup can easily rival or, in many cases, surpass the performance figures of some of the best gas-powered cars out there. A prime example would be Teslas iconic Model S. The Model S Plaid+ comes equipped with mind-boggling specs, boasting a top speed of 200 mph (321 km/h) and an acceleration rate of 0 to 60 mph (0 to 97 km/h) in under two seconds. The Model S has managed to break the long-standing norms in automotive performance metrics.

Innovative Battery Tech: Teslas Range Supremacy

Teslas success in the electric vehicle market is closely linked to its groundbreaking battery technology. The company is relentlessly working on improving and innovating battery designs, making long-range electric travel more accessible and viable. As of now, Tesla claims the highest range per charge in the electric vehicle market. The Model S Long Range Plus boasts an impressive EPA-estimated range of 402 miles (647 km) on a single charge. These numbers are expected to improve with the companys continued advancements in battery designs and energy management systems.

Ubiquitous Superchargers: Teslas Charging Network

Teslas emphasis on building convenient charging networks for its users is one of the key reasons behind its overarching success. The Tesla Supercharger network spans across countries, providing strategically positioned charging points for its users. With over 25,000 Superchargers spread across 2400+ stations in more than 45 countries, Tesla has made long trips in electric vehicles stress-free and incredibly feasible. Further expansion of the network is always in the plans as the company expands its reach to new markets and regions.

Enhancing Autonomous Driving: Teslas Autopilot Success

Teslas continuous improvements in its Autopilot technology have made assisted driving an incredible reality. The companys data reveals that, in Q1 2021, Tesla vehicles registered one accident for every 4.19 million miles driven when the Autopilot was engaged. In comparison, vehicles not equipped with Autopilot registered one accident for every 2.05 million miles driven. Furthermore, the company is hard at work on advancing its Full Self-Driving (FSD) capabilities, making regular updates and refining the algorithms to achieve fully autonomous driving in the future.

Energy Storage: Teslas Powerwall and Powerpack Deployments

Teslas dominance does not end in the domain of automobiles. The companys foray into the sustainable energy market has been equally impressive. Teslas Powerwall and Powerpack solutions facilitate energy storage, balancing the energy grid, and easing the shift toward renewables. The company has deployed a total energy storage capacity of 3.0-gigawatt hours globally till date. Furthermore, with exciting grid-scale projects such as the Hornsdale Power Reserve in South Australia, Tesla continues to push the boundaries in unlocking the true potential of renewable energy.
